    Make a backup in Backup Manager, and download the latest Image (ViX 3.2-010) using Image Manager.
    These are found by the press of the blue button and ViX.
    In Image Manager press the blue button to restore the latest image you have downloaded and it will do the rest for you. When the flashing is completed. Setup as you were setting up as new (I.e. HDMI, 1080p, Multi etc) then you will be asked if you want to restore settings. Say YES at this point. Then you will be asked if you want to restore plugins, Say NO at this point and when completed reinstall your plugins. On doing the settings restore you will still have your ABM settings and your Cam settings intact.
    In my opinion, always best to be on latest image, you will then get all the latest enhancements, drivers etc.

    Hi Jap, if you still haven't install mediaportal look at the 2nd post on the this tread...there is also advice on other posts on this tread on how to use telnet.

    http://www.world-of-satellite.com/sh...l-wont-install

    I used DCC (Dreambox Control Centre) to telnet my box, but you need to copy and paste the command below in telnet.

    init 4
    opkg install enigma2-plugin-extensions-mediaportal --force-depends
    init 3

    it is far easier to copy this:

    init 4
    opkg install enigma2-plugin-extensions-mediaportal --force-depends
    init 3

    then paste it next to the # by using the middle button that looks a bit like camera (if you hold the cursor over it spells "Einfugen" I think that is German for paste) that box is above root@vusolo2:~#

    When you have a command line that looks like (I have the solo2 yours should show Duo) this hit the enter key and then you should have mediaportal after the receiver restarts.

    root@vusolo2:~# init 4
    root@vusolo2:~# opkg install enigma2-plugin-extensions-mediaportal --force-dep
    nds
    Package enigma2-plugin-extensions-mediaportal (7.2.0) installed in root is up todate.
    root@vusolo2:~# init 3

    I have only used this once myself as I am new to the VUbox but it did work for me...I may be wrong but you may need to have already installed mediaportal from the plugin feed before telneting the box even though it does not show in the installed plugins.
